K4M51163LE - Y(P)C/L/F
8M x 16Bit x 4 Banks Mobile SDRAM in 54FBGA
FEATURES
• 2.5V power supply.
• LVCMOS compatible with multiplexed address.
• Four banks operation.
• MRS cycle with address key programs.
-. CAS latency (1, 2 & 3).
-. Burst length (1, 2, 4, 8 & Full page).
-. Burst type (Sequential & Interleave).
• EMRS cycle with address key programs.
• All inputs are sampled at the positive going edge of the system
clock.
• Burst read single-bit write operation.
• Special Function Support.
-. PASR (Partial Array Self Refresh).
-. Internal TCSR (Temperature Compensated Self Refresh)
• DQM for masking.
• Auto refresh.
64ms refresh period (8K cycle).
Commercial Temperature Operation (-25°C ~ 70°C).
1 /CS Support.
2chips DDP 54Balls FBGA with 0.8mm ball pitch
( -YXXX : Leaded, -PXXX : Lead Free).
Mobile-SDRAM
GENERAL DESCRIPTION
The K4M51163LE is 536,870,912 bits synchronous high data
rate Dynamic RAM organized as 4 x 8,388,608 words by 16 bits,
fabricated with SAMSUNG’s high performance CMOS technol-
ogy. Synchronous design allows precise cycle control with the
use of system clock and I/O transactions are possible on every
clock cycle. Range of operating frequencies, programmable
burst lengths and programmable latencies allow the same
device to be useful for a variety of high bandwidth and high per-
formance memory system applications.
